[Therion] Person data type with more than two names
Bruce Mutton
bruce at tomo.co.nz
Sat Jul 15 04:12:13 CEST 2017
Thanks Olly
Can rely on you for a clear and rational explanation!
I've added a bit on the wiki
https://therion.speleo.sk/wiki/drawingchecklist#scrap
and plagiarised your text on the FAQ page as well.
https://therion.speleo.sk/wiki/faq#how_do_i_add_peoples_names_if_they_have_more_than_two_words_names
Bruce
-----Original Message-----
From: Olly Betts [mailto:olly at survex.com]
Sent: Saturday, 15 July 2017 1:24 PM
To: Bruce Mutton via Therion <therion at speleo.sk>
Cc: Bruce Mutton <bruce at tomo.co.nz>
Subject: Re: [Therion] Person data type with more than two names
On Sat, Jul 15, 2017 at 12:06:43PM +1200, Bruce Mutton via Therion wrote:
> Therion Book says of this data type:
>
> person a person s first name and surname separated by whitespace
> characters. Use / to separate first name and surname if there are
> more names.
Perhaps more clearly: a person can have at most two names (name1 and name2).
If there's a "/" then that separates the name1 and name2 (which can then contain spaces), otherwise whitespace separates name1 and name2. So multiple "/" is an error, as is multiple whitespace without a "/".
At least that's what the code appears to do, and it's consistent with all your examples.
I guess it's up to the user how best to separate a person's fairly arbitrary number of names into at most two groups.
Just be careful never to go surveying with someone with a "/" in their name...
Cheers,
Olly
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mailman.speleo.sk/pipermail/therion/attachments/20170715/19aaf714/attachment.htm>
More information about the Therion
mailing list